#71E7FE Color
#71E7FE is rgb(113, 231, 254) in RGB, hsl(190, 99%, 72%) in HSL, and about cmyk(56%, 9%, 0%, 0%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Sky Blue (Crayola) (#76D7EA),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.06.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#71E7FE Channel Values
How #71E7FE bre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 113 · G 231 · B 254 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 190° · S 99% · L 72%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 190° · S 56% · V 100%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 56% · M 9% · Y 0% · K 0%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.44:1 vs white · 14.56: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#71E7FE background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#71E7FE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#71E7FE?
#71E7FE is a light teal — rgb(113, 231, 254) in RGB and hsl(190, 99%, 72%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Sky Blue (Crayola) (#76D7EA),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.06.
What is the RGB value of #71E7FE?
#71E7FE is rgb(113, 231, 254) — red 113, green 231, and blue 254 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#71E7FE?
#71E7FE converts to approximately cmyk(56%, 9%, 0%, 0%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#71E7FE be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#71E7FE scores 1.44:1 against white and 14.56: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#71E7FE as a CSS color keyword?
No. #71E7FE is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is skyblue (#87CEEB) at a CIE76 distance of 14.17, which is visibly different.
